Dear Listers: Does anyone have any experience with putting together interpretive materials for use underwater, close to shore, 8' max depth, salinty constant. Im looking for something that will resist erosion to a point and that will also resist bioaccumulation, and there will be regular maintenance. I was thinking fiberglass sheets, embedded in some sort of clear matrix, or plastic, or something. Folks nust have the ability to read the signage, any suggestions? Nothing toxic! Thanks
